Green Lantern

"In brightest day, in blackest night, no evil shall escape my sight! Let those who worship evil's might, beware my power." With those words, the Green Lantern, one of the world's oldest and most popular comic book superheroes, has gone forth to police the universe since 1940. There have been many different Green Lanterns over the years, and many changes made to the character, but his essential nature as a champion of good remains constant.
